I have been sent some front driveshaft pins to try on the Yokomo Bmax when running the hex adapter. Running the hex adapter allows you to run:
Losi Front Wheels
Associated Front Wheels
Jconcepts Rolux Front Wheels.
The standard pin that is included in the kit is not the same overall length as the o/d of the hex. This could sheer of or cause excess play in the hex/wheel. The new Nortech driveshaft pins have the same length as the hex o/d therefore much stronger and less chance of causing damage or excess play.
